Output 77604da4532c26a8f42dc9d64e97aa375f923d672929aee5659bc0dcefb070be:0

value
152966268
script pubkey
OP_0 OP_PUSHBYTES_20 ee7f96c157236d049c83defbb0ef917822b0e2ee
address
ltc1qaeleds2hydksf8yrmmampmu30q3tpchwk6nuqx
transaction
77604da4532c26a8f42dc9d64e97aa375f923d672929aee5659bc0dcefb070be
spent
true